About Lubbock
Lubbock is a city located in United States, in the Texas region. With a recorded population of 249,042, it is home to a diverse community of residents.
Geographically, Lubbock lies at coordinates 33.58°N, 101.86°W, placing it in the Northern Western Hemisphere. The city operates on the America/Chicago timezone, which governs daily life and business hours for its inhabitants.
